Shabbadu makes first hire in Angus Smallwood, launches summer freelance service
Melbourne copywriting service Shabbadu, the brainchild of former Clemenger BBDO creative Chris Taylor who launched the venture in April, has hired its first member of staff – the former actor, voice-over artist, comedy writer and journalist Angus Smallwood.
Smallwood, who career includes writing roles at SapientNitro, Leap Agency and Old Bull Productions, as well as a stint as a coffee shop reviewer for The Age, joins Shabbadu as creative consultant.
The Shabbadu model invites clients to prepay for a batch of hours per month, which they then use in hour blocks as the need arises. Shabbadu has picked up work on both agency and client side since launch.
